Pára, Pedro! (1969): Adventure & Comedy Classic – Full Movie Info

Pára, Pedro! (1969) is a spirited Brazilian adventure-comedy that blends mistaken identity with a wild chase through Rio Grande do Sul's rugged landscapes. Directed by Pereira Dias, this 85-minute gem follows Pedro, a cowboy who flees a town under a cloud of confusion, only to find his lover Rosário sending a hired gunslinger, Alegrete, on a mission to bring him back safely. What begins as a straightforward pursuit quickly spirals into chaos, thanks to Alegrete's hapless nephew, whose bumbling antics turn every ambush into a comedic disaster.

The film captures the essence of mid-centuryBrazilian cinema with its mix of humor, heart, and regional charm, all wrapped in a fast-paced narrative that keeps viewers laughing. Pereira Dias' direction balances lighthearted fun with a touch of dramatic tension, creating an atmosphere that feels both nostalgic and timeless.
